How did you build your audience on social media?
I built my audience on social media by being myself, I didn’t ride any waves to trying to mimic anyone else I saw but I was inspired by many creators in my space which lead to where I am today. I stayed consistent even when I didn’t feel like posting because I know there’s a higher purpose to what I’m doing and the message I want to get out. Last but not least I invested in myself to get my content seen and in front of more people so that I could potentially help or simply just inspire people from all over the world. Advice for those just starting to build a social media presence would be to stick too what you’re good at or know and thrive off of that and push it no matter what. Long as you’re happy and feel confident putting out your content you just let the algorithm do its thing, interactive with your audience and keep growing from there.
